Cardinal Health operates globally across the U.S., Canada, Europe, and Asia, serving hospitals, pharmacies, surgical centers, and labs. Its Pharmaceutical division distributes branded, generic, and specialty drugs, manages nuclear pharmacies, and provides medication therapy and pharmacy management services. The Medical division manufactures and distributes proprietary surgical and laboratory products, including gloves, needles, wound care, and procedure kits, while providing comprehensive supply chain solutions.
